Transaction 593d75481496e5c6b8cd82e09b69eb69909c6721c05c5fdb36a7e4ec2533d93c

1 Input
2 Outputs
  • 593d75481496e5c6b8cd82e09b69eb69909c6721c05c5fdb36a7e4ec2533d93c:0
  • value  11494701028
    address  2N5dERyGfzbn4Z3bBfAjtzZvz7ssvouX8T6
  • 593d75481496e5c6b8cd82e09b69eb69909c6721c05c5fdb36a7e4ec2533d93c:1
  • value  70000
    address  2MwQAbNAKz9qosCk2w3s8iHZreUHSWxMhSN